System Hardware Engineering Tester – Natus Neuro

Job Summary

Natus Neuro is seeking a highly skilled System Tester to play a key role in ensuring the quality and reliability of our current product portfolio and next-generation medical devices. In this role, you will be instrumental in verifying that our platforms meet the highest performance, regulatory, and safety standards.

As a System Tester, you will work in adynamic, collaborative environment, partnering with software, hardware, product security, and engineering teams to test, validate, and document system performance across all product lines. Your work will directly contribute to delivering innovative and high-quality medical technology to healthcare providers and patients worldwide.

Key Responsibilities

Hardware testing

  • Create and own end-to-end test infrastructures
  • Create hardware verification plans, test cases, and automated test protocols based on system architecture and design requirements.
  • Continuous collaboration and constant communication with the Hardware, Software, Cloud, and Manufacturing engineering teams to develop test plans, test stations, and validation strategies based on technical requirements
  • Strong expertise in the bring-up and debugging of custom digital hardware with microcontrollers, application processors, and various analog/digital peripherals.
  • Test and analyze wired (Ethernet, USB, RS-232, UART) and wireless devices (BLE, Wi-Fi, cellular) for security, reliability, and networked connectivity for control or transmission of sensitive clinical data
  • Perform pre-compliance and formal testing for global medical standards, including IEC 60601 (Safety/EMC), RoHS, and environmental limits
  • Hands-on proficiency with lab instruments (oscilloscopes, function generators, RF network analyzers, power supplies)
